


Compile eAccelerator.dll for PHP 5.2.12 and 5.2.13 under Windows (with download)_PHP tutorial
First of all, let me explain some of my parameters:
Operating system: Windows 7 Ultimate
Web Server: Apache 2.2.14
Visual Studio: 6.0 (don’t dislike it because it is an old version, even under Win7 It can still be used, of course you can use Visual Studio 2008)
What is eAccelerator?
eaccelerator is a free and open source PHP accelerator that optimizes and dynamic content caching, improves the caching performance of PHP scripts, and almost completely eliminates the server overhead of PHP scripts in the compiled state. It also optimizes scripts to speed up their execution efficiency.
1. First download the compiled PHP binary package. (Will be used later) The address is as follows:
http://cn.php.net/distributions/php-5.2.12-Win32.zip
http://cn.php.net/distributions/php-5.2.13-Win32.zip
2. Download the PHP source code, which will be used later when compiling eAccelerator. The address is as follows:
http://cn2.php.net/get/php-5.2.12.tar.bz2/from/a/mirror
http://cn2.php.net/get/php-5.2.13.tar.bz2/from/a/mirror
3. Upgrade PHP:
This process is very simple. First, close Apache, and then replace all the files extracted from the compressed package with the original files. For example, if your original PHP program file is located in D:php, then please decompress php-5.2.13-Win32.zip (or php-5.2.12-Win32.zip) to this path to overwrite the original file.
4. Start Apache, we will receive an error message and Apache cannot start. Open the Apache log file (the file path is apachelogserror.log), we will see this prompt message:
PHP Warning: [eAccelerator] This build of "eAccelerator" was compiled for PHP version 5.2.11.
Rebuild it for your PHP version (5.2.13) or download precompiled binaries.
It means that the current eAccelerator is compiled for PHP 5.2.11 and is not suitable for 5.2.13. We should recompile eAccelerator.
5. Download a copy of the source code of eAccelerator. The address is as follows:
http://bart.eaccelerator.net/source/0.9.5.3/eaccelerator-0.9.5.3.zip
6. Unzip the PHP source code downloaded in step 2 to a directory, such as E:php. Then open your PHP program directory (that is, the directory where your php.exe is located), find the php5ts.lib file in the dev subdirectory, and copy it to the location E:php.
7. Open E:phpext, create a directory below and name it eaccelerator, and then extract the compressed package downloaded in step 5 into this directory. The directory structure at this time should be like this:
8. Open the win32 subdirectory, there should be a project file named eAccelerator.dsw, open it with the VS development environment (for example, I use VS6.0), open "Components" > "Configuration", Select the option Win32 Release PHP5 and click "Close".
9. Press the F7 key (or select the edit button in the toolbar) to start compilation. Wait for a moment, the compilation is successful, and you can see a generated file in the win32 directory. Release subdirectory, open this subdirectory, and you will see that the eAccelerator.dll file has been generated.
Copy this file to your PHP extension directory (such as D:phpext), replace the original file, and then start Apache, you will find that eAccelerator has been loaded successfully.
